Location
Reefton is a small community town on New Zealand’s West Coast region, one hour northeast of Greymouth. A historic goldmining town, which still has a great deal of historic charm. Follow the town’s heritage walk past the Reefton School of Mines, the Courthouse, Oddfellows Hall, and the Band Hall. You may wish to experience the gold mining tours, and see how gold was mined back in the 1880s. Surrounding Reefton is the stunning West Coast where you can experience beautiful native forests, glacier walks, coastal seal colonies and much more.
